#9ed8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9ed8ff is composed of 62% red, 84.7%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 204.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 81%. #9ed8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3db1ff.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#9ed8ff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9ed8ff has RGB values of R:158, G:216,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 10410239.

Shades and Tints of #9ed8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#ecf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ed8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cfd2 is the less saturated color, while #9ed8ff is the most saturated one.
